Where to find better romance book recommendations?

4 Answers2025-08-21 19:23:35
As someone who spends way too much time diving into romance novels, I've found that the best recommendations often come from niche communities and platforms tailored to book lovers. Goodreads is my go-to; their lists like 'Best Contemporary Romance' or 'Enemies to Lovers Done Right' are goldmines. I also follow booktubers like 'PeruseProject'—their monthly wrap-ups introduce me to hidden gems. For more interactive recs, Discord servers like 'The Romance Book Club' are fantastic. Members share personalized suggestions based on tropes or moods, like 'slow burn with witty banter.' TikTok’s #BookTok is another treasure trove, especially for trending titles like 'The Love Hypothesis' or 'People We Meet on Vacation.' Blogs like 'Smart Bitches, Trashy Books' offer hilarious yet insightful reviews. Don’t overlook library staff picks—they’re surprisingly spot-on!

What are the best love book recommendations for romance fans?

3 Answers2025-09-01 13:55:18
Diving into romance novels is like stepping into a cozy blanket on a rainy day; it's comforting and filled with delightful surprises. One of my all-time favorites is 'Pride and Prejudice' by Jane Austen. The sharp wit, societal pressures, and the evolving relationship between Elizabeth Bennet and Mr. Darcy create a dance of tension and humor that I can't resist. There's so much to unravel in their relationship, from misunderstandings to the delightful banter that makes their journey so relatable. Plus, who doesn't love a happily-ever-after after all the trials? Then there's 'The Hating Game' by Sally Thorne, a contemporary enemies-to-lovers story that’s the perfect whirlwind for anyone who thrives on tension and chemistry. The playful rivalry between Lucy and Joshua makes me giggle and root for them at every turn! What truly gets me is how the sizzling tension shifts into something deeper, building toward that 'aha' moment when they finally realize their heart’s desires. With romantic comedies being my guilty pleasure, this book had me laughing and swooning—a perfect duo! Another gem is 'Eleanor Oliphant Is Completely Fine' by Gail Honeyman. It's not your textbook romance, but the slow-building connection between Eleanor and Raymond struck me in the feels. It captures the unpredictability of love in unexpected places, showing how relationships can heal and transform us. All three of these books resonate uniquely, and I think they can satisfy any romance fan looking to escape into a world of love and all its intricacies.

Where can I find new books to read in fiction romance?

3 Answers2026-03-30 03:19:24
Romance fiction is my guilty pleasure, and I’m always hunting for fresh titles to dive into. One of my go-to spots is Goodreads—their recommendation engine is scarily accurate once you’ve rated a few books. I’ll often browse lists like 'Best Slow Burn Romances' or 'Underrated Fantasy Romance' and end up with a TBR pile taller than my nightstand. Kindle Unlimited is another goldmine, especially for indie authors. I stumbled upon 'The Love Hypothesis' there before it blew up, and now I trust their algorithm like a bookish oracle. BookTok and Bookstagram are also fantastic for discovering hidden gems. Creators like @spivey’sbookshelf or @romancewithwings have introduced me to swoon-worthy reads I’d never find otherwise. Just be prepared for your wallet to weep—their enthusiasm is contagious. Lately, I’ve been loving newsletter recs from platforms like Fated Mates or Smart Bitches, Trashy Books for curated picks with hilarious commentary. It’s like having a romance-loving best friend whispering recommendations in your ear.
